The Agua+S project under development in the Spanish region of Andalucia is aimed at combining a desalination plant, a pumping station network, and an onshore, floating photovoltaic plant in a single project design. According to its developers this is the first time that these three facilities have been combined together in a fully reproducible design that could be replicated in any river basin that has a reservoir and is close to the coast, to produce fresh water for both irrigation and human consumption.

The German battery manufacturer said this week its residential storage systems were automatically switched to a regulated stand-by mode in Germany. The background to the remote shutdown is three reports of explosions in houses in which Senec products were installed.
Researchers from Qatar and South Korea have studied the potential of solar cells based on 2D MXenes materials. They said that titanium carbide MXene (Ti3C2Tx) is the most promising material in the MXene family for PV applications.
